BOSKY, adjective. Having abundant bushes, shrubs or trees.
BOSKY, adjective. Caused by trees or shrubs.
BOSKY, adjective. Bushy, bristling.
Dictionary definition
BOSKY, adjective. Covered with or consisting of bushes or thickets; "brushy undergrowth"; "`bosky' is a literary term"; "a bosky park leading to a modest yet majestic plaza"- Jack Beatty.
